Settlers along the Ohio and Mississippi rivers used these waterways routes to ship there products south?

Keel boats and later steam boats carried raw materials to New Orleans and carried manufactured goods back up the rivers. During the American Revolutionary War, Daniel Boone used a keel boat to bring ammunition from New Orleans up the Mississippi and Tennessee rivers and the French Broad to Western North Carolina. The Americans used it for the battle of Kings Mountain.

What waterways were used to transport goods in the south?

In the southern United States, key waterways for transporting goods included the Mississippi River and its tributaries, which facilitated the movement of agricultural products like cotton and tobacco. The Atlantic Intracoastal Waterway also played a significant role in connecting various coastal ports for trade. Additionally, smaller rivers and canals were utilized for local transport, enhancing the region's economic connectivity. Overall, these waterways were crucial for the South's agricultural economy and trade networks.
